Looking for advice on setting up my E7 with a Skookum SK 540 along with the following Futuba BLS255HV and BLS256HV High Voltage Servos. 

My intent is to power direct using a 2 Cell lipo and curious if I need to utilize Skookum Soft Switch Power Bus.  Or can I simply run them unregulated.
